Ingredients
2 (7.25 ounces) bags Pepperidge Farm Chessman cookies
2 cups milk
1 (5.1 ounce) box instant vanilla pudding
1 (14-oz) can sweetened condensed milk
1 (8-ounce ) package cream cheese, softened at room temperature
1 (12-ounce) container frozen whipped topping, thawed
6 – 8 medium bananas (sliced ½” thick)*
How To Make Not Yo’ Mama’s Banana Pudding
In a large mixing bowl, using electric hand mixer, combine milk and instant pudding mix. Mix on low speed until combined and thickened, about two minutes.
